History

The group was formed in 1987, while each of its four members were studying at the University of Washington

Name change

The Coats were originally known as "The Trenchcoats," but following the Columbine High School massacre

, they became unintentionally associated with the Trenchcoat Mafia. Numerous news reports erroneously provided the singing group's web address as that of the killers, so it was quickly simplified to their group's current name.

Discography

The Coats have released eleven albums as of December 2009:
  • 1992: It Turns Me On
  • 1994: Your Joy
  • 1995: Exposed
  • 1996: Are You Up?
  • 1999: When I'm With You
  • 2000: The Coats Collection
  • 2000: On Christmas Time
  • 2002: The Boys Are Back
  • 2005: Last a Lifetime
  • 2006: The Caroler - Christmas with The Coats
  • 2009: The Coats - Caught On Tape


According to their site, The Coats are currently recording a twelfth album at a "secret location near Seattle." However, that quote has been on their site since 2005 prior to the release of "Last A Lifetime".
